MVP? Westbrook has Monstrous Game in Orlando

Orlando, Fla. – – Russell Westbrook is a monster, and he proved that basketball nightmares can become reality against the Orlando Magic on Wednesday. Westbrook scored 57 points, 19 in the fourth quarter alone, to complete a freakish triple double that included 11 assists and 13 rebounds. This total represented the most points scored in […]

Westbrook, Durant Lead Thunder Past Magic in 2OT

ORLANDO, Fla – The Orlando Magic welcomed Kevin Durant and the Oklahoma City Thunder into the Amway Center on Friday, losing 136-139 in a double OT thriller. Durant and his All-Star teammate Russell Westbrook combined for 91 points, willing their team to victory down the stretch. The Magic led by as many as 18 points […]
